Compartir a través de


Ejemplo de script de PowerShell: Crear un equipo y asignar una directiva de mensajería.

Use este script de PowerShell para crear una directiva de mensajería en Microsoft Teams y asignarla a los usuarios.

Para obtener más información sobre el uso de este script de PowerShell, vea Inicio rápido: Teams para Educación.

Este script usa el cmdlet Grant-CsTeamsMessagingPolicy que se encuentra en el módulo de PowerShell de Skype Empresarial Online. Consulte Introducción a Teams PowerShell para obtener más información sobre cómo administrar Teams con PowerShell.

Antes de empezar

Descargue e instale el módulo Skype Empresarial PowerShell en línea y, a continuación, reinicie el equipo si se le solicita.

Para obtener más información, consulte Administrar Skype Empresarial en línea con Office 365 PowerShell.

Ejemplo de script

<#
.SYNOPSIS
This script creates a messaging policy in Teams and assigns it to users.
.DESCRIPTION
Use this script to create a messaging policy and assign it to users in your organization.
#>

$dataSetFilePath = "<csv file with user ids for newly provisioned students> "
 $dataSet = Import-Csv "$($dataSetFilePath)" -Header UserId –delimiter ","
 foreach($line in $dataSet)
 {
    $userId = $line.UserId
    Write-Host $userId
    Grant-CsTeamsMessagingPolicy -PolicyName "<<PolicyName for a policy created with Chat Off>>" -Identity $userId

 }

Nota

También puede asignar una directiva de mensajería directamente a los usuarios a escala a través de una asignación de directiva de lote o a un grupo del que los usuarios son miembros. Para obtener más información, vea Asignar directivas a grandes conjuntos de usuarios de su centro educativo y Asignar directivas a los usuarios en Teams.